How Advanced Urine Tests Help to Diagnostic Medical Conditions

Advanced urinalysis techniques are not your everyday urine tests. They involve using high-tech equipment and methods to thoroughly examine urine samples, providing detailed insights into our body’s metabolic, endocrine, and renal functions. Here’s how advanced urine tests for medical conditions work:

Chemical Analysis

This method involves using sophisticated equipment to measure the levels of various substances in urine. For instance, a higher-than-average glucose level could indicate diabetes, while an elevated protein level might suggest kidney disease.

These tests can detect even minute quantities of these substances, making them highly accurate.

Microscopic Examination

This technique places the urine sample under a microscope. This allows healthcare professionals to identify cells, crystals, bacteria, or other substances not usually present in urine.

For example, the presence of red blood cells might suggest urinary tract diseases like kidney stones or bladder infections. Identifying these abnormalities early on can prevent further complications.

Molecular Testing

This cutting-edge method involves identifying specific genes, proteins, or other molecules in the urine. For example, molecular testing can detect the presence of specific cancer markers, aiding in the early diagnosis of bladder or kidney cancers.

It can also diagnose genetic disorders by detecting mutations or changes in DNA sequences.

Decoding Urinalysis: Your Health Team’s Role

When diagnosing complex conditions with urinalysis, your healthcare team is indispensable. These professionals have the knowledge and experience to interpret the results of these specific tests accurately.

Advanced urinalysis for medical diagnosis isn’t a one-person show. It involves a collective effort where healthcare professionals collaborate to make sense of the data. Take, for example, diagnosing a urinary tract infection (UTI).

After collecting the urine sample for analysis, the laboratory specialists put it under chemical and microscopic examination. This way, they can detect abnormalities such as high levels of nitrites – a standard indicator of a UTI.

These results then go to the physician, who interprets the data regarding the patient’s symptoms and medical history. If a UTI is confirmed, the physician explains this condition to you and discusses potential causes for any abnormalities. Finally, they prescribe you the appropriate antibiotics for treatment.
